• ADADADADAD

    javascript 列表控件[ 编程知识 ]

    编程知识 时间:2024-11-29 10:06:11

    作者:文/会员上传

    简介:

    Javascript是一种流行的编程语言,支持多种操作和功能,其中列表控件是其中一种强大的功能。列表控件是一种常用的UI控件,能够帮助用户轻松实现数据展示和操作。在Javascript中,列

    以下为本文的正文内容,内容仅供参考!本站为公益性网站,复制本文以及下载DOC文档全部免费。

    Javascript是一种流行的编程语言,支持多种操作和功能,其中列表控件是其中一种强大的功能。列表控件是一种常用的UI控件,能够帮助用户轻松实现数据展示和操作。在Javascript中,列表控件是一个非常重要的组成部分,因为它能够大大提高用户在页面上的操作效率。一、基础概念和实现方法列表控件通常由HTML标签
        组成,分别代表有序和无序的列表。它们分别包含一个或多个< li>(列表项目)标签,用于呈现列表项的文本或图像。Javascript可以通过DOM(文档对象模型)引用这些标签,并动态设置、修改和删除它们。这些标签支持CSS样式,并可以使用Javascript事件响应来实现响应式列表控件。下面是一个基本示例,它创建了一个无序列表,并在每个列表项中插入一个超链接:
        • Item 1
        • Item 2
        • Item 3
        二、列表控件样式和功能列表控件的样式和功能是可以通过CSS和Javascript来自定义和扩展的。下面是一个例子,它实现了一个折叠式列表,用户可以单击列表头部来打开或关闭列表项。
        • Item 1
          • Item 1-1
          • Item 1-2
        • Item 2
          • Item 2-1
          • Item 2-2
        • Item 3
          • Item 3-1
          • Item 3-2
        这个例子中,通过Javascript来响应元素的单击事件,并通过CSS样式来定义折叠式列表控件的样式。三、列表控件的优化列表控件在实现上需要注意的一些优化技巧:1. 异步数据加载:对于大型列表控件(如数千个项目),可以通过异步数据加载来减轻页面的负担,加快页面响应速度。2. 虚拟化列表项:对于使用垂直滚动条的大型列表控件,可以使用虚拟化列表项来降低内存占用和增加渲染速度。3. 缓存列表项:对于频繁更新的列表控件,可以通过缓存已经渲染的列表项来提升页面性能。4. 惰性加载列表项:对于包含许多子项的列表控件,可以使用惰性加载来提高性能和减少页面加载时间。惰性加载只在用户需要时才加载对应的列表项,而不是一次性渲染所有子项。四、总结列表控件是Javascript中一个非常重要的组件,它可以帮助用户实现数据展示和操作。通过CSS和Javascript的样式和功能扩展,可以实现很多丰富的列表控件,如折叠式列表,树形列表和虚拟化列表等。在实现列表控件时,需要注意一些优化技巧,如异步数据加载、虚拟化列表项、缓存列表项和惰性加载列表项等。这些技巧可以提高页面性能,减少内存占用和加快渲染速度。
    javascript 列表控件.docx

    将本文的Word文档下载到电脑

    推荐度:

    下载